The "Little Russia" Music page features a Recordings Presentation, containing more than 200 audio and 13 video clips , a collection of Russian romantic songs , POP Music , and artists' songs and lyrics. The lyrics have been saved in GIF format and do not require any Russian font for reading. Many images are "sensitive" - that is, the text is read aloud when you click on it. Currently, some 50+ songs are presented in au format. Some of them are accompanied by Quicktime movie clips.

X.500 gateway to Russia (RU domain). People often ask whether there is a "white pages" for the Internet -- a directory of people, computers, services, as well as electronic mail addresses. The X.500 standard is now being used to implement such a service. Please try it if you are looking for someone in Russia.
